Comment convertir QBasic en Visual Basic

...

Les langages de programmation ont évolué à partir des cartes perforées.

Le langage de programmation simple QBasic a été livré avec chaque ordinateur DOS dans les années 80 et au début des années 90. Le langage Visual Basic de Microsoft l'a depuis remplacé, permettant aux amateurs d'écrire des programmes qui utilisent l'interface Windows au lieu de la ligne de commande. Les deux langues sont cependant largement compatibles, ce qui vous permet de convertir facilement votre code QBasic dans la langue la plus courante.

Étape 1

Renommez l'extension de fichier de votre programme QBasic de ".bas" à ".txt" et ignorez les messages d'avertissement.

Vidéo du jour

Étape 2

Ouvrez Visual Basic et double-cliquez sur "Bouton" dans la boîte à outils pour l'ajouter à votre formulaire. Modifiez la propriété de texte du bouton dans le panneau de droite pour « Démarrer ».

Étape 3

Double-cliquez sur le bouton pour ouvrir sa page de code. Sélectionnez « Modifier » > « Insérer un fichier » et choisissez votre fichier texte de code QBasic. Cela exécutera votre code QBasic lorsque l'utilisateur cliquera sur le bouton Démarrer.

Étape 4

Modifiez le code QBasic pour vous conformer aux normes Visual Basic. Notez la présence de lignes qui ressemblent à ce qui suit :

IF INKEY$ = A ALORS BEEP INPUT "Entrez un nombre"; Z

Remplacez-les par les lignes suivantes de code Visual Basic, en personnalisant les noms de variables et les messages d'invite si nécessaire :

Si KeyAscii = 65 Then Beep EndIf Z = InputBox("Entrez un nombre")

Supprimez toutes les déclarations "SCREEN" et remplacez la commande "WINDOW" par "Scale".

Étape 5

Cliquez sur la flèche verte dans la barre d'outils pour exécuter le programme. Si tout fonctionne correctement, cliquez sur le bouton "Démarrer" pour exécuter. Si vous recevez une erreur de commande non reconnue, consultez la documentation Visual Basic pour trouver le remplacement approprié à utiliser à la place de la commande QBasic obsolète.